Output 31aed1ab60f8b2174da781ac85c707f34d0f5b58a253099aa8f7c28ad21576d0:22
- value
- 59883066
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fdd0c380a31c4503df7983eebf47a57ae1086b8
- address
- bc1q0lwscwq2x8z9q00hnqlwhar627hppp4ccza8rs
- transaction
- 31aed1ab60f8b2174da781ac85c707f34d0f5b58a253099aa8f7c28ad21576d0